Subject: On-call handover — Routeweaver heuristic

Taking over from tonight. The driver-assignment heuristic in Routeweaver is degrading under the Calderport zone load; fallback to round-robin triggered twice. I bumped the candidate pool size as a stopgap — revert once the scoring fix ships. Future maintainers: don't tune weights without replaying the Calderport traffic capture first. Full notes are in the incident doc. Questions during the handover window should go to the address below.

pager mailbox: istael.fenwyn@qorvelworks.corp

**Action Item 4: Partition ledger tables by month.** The January incident showed that full-table scans on Quillbase's ledger grow unbounded. We will migrate to monthly partitions with a 13-month retention window, owned by the Storage Pod, due end of Q2. New team members should review the partitioning design and rollout plan on the internal page below.

runbook for badug-kadup: https://confluence.zemvarlabs.internal/projects/browse/display/projects/bd1b

Handover: Exportron retry queue

Hi Mira — handing over the failed-export retries. Exports that hit a timeout land in the retry queue and get three attempts with backoff; after that they're parked and need a manual requeue from the admin panel. Watch for customers reporting duplicates — that usually means a double requeue. The current retry settings are as follows.

settings of bajog-fawig:
oliael:
  log_level: warn
  metrics_host: metrics.oliael.zemvarsys.internal
  pin: 0267
  pool_size: 32

### Alert: DepViz render latency breach

For the weekly sync: the DepViz dependency graph visualizer fired its render-latency alert three times this week. Graphs over 4,000 nodes exceed the 30s render budget, tripping the p95 threshold. Root cause appears to be the new transitive-edge expansion feature shipped in release 12.4. Mitigation: edge expansion is now behind a flag, default off. Ownership questions or threshold tuning requests should go to the Vantage tooling group at the address below.

escalation mailbox, bafog-fafog: ulador@paliqlabs.internal